How Pittsburgh’s Hilly Topography Attacks Residential Foundations

There is a reason the Greater Pittsburgh region is celebrated for its stunning vistas, rolling hills, and historic neighborhoods. But while our steep hillsides create beautiful landscapes, they pose a serious engineering challenge for residential foundations. Unlike flatter metropolitan areas, Pittsburgh homes are locked in a continuous battle with gravity, complex water paths, and moving terrain.

When a home is built on or near a slope, the foundation walls experience highly unequal structural loads. The uphill side of the basement must hold back the weight of the climbing hillside, while the downhill side is left exposed. When heavy rain or winter snowmelt saturates the ground, water naturally runs downhill, collecting behind uphill foundation walls and putting intense physical stress on your home’s underground framework.

The Local Soil Enemy: Expansive Pittsburgh Clay and Foundation Cracks

Compounding our rolling landscape is the specific composition of Western Pennsylvania soil. The ground here is packed with dense, highly expansive clay. Clay particles absorb water like a massive sponge. When the soil becomes saturated, it expands in volume, generating an aggressive horizontal force known as hydrostatic pressure.

As this wet clay expands against an uphill basement wall, it functions like a slow-motion battering ram. Because concrete blocks and poured concrete walls have low tensile strength, they eventually buckle under this lateral weight. This pressure results in long, horizontal cracks running along the middle mortar joints or causes the entire wall to bow inward toward the basement floor.

On the downhill side of the property, a different threat emerges: soil creep. Over time, gravity slowly pulls the soft, wet topsoil down the slope. If your downhill foundation footings were not anchored deep enough into solid bedrock during initial construction, the soil beneath them can wash away or drop, causing your home to tilt, sink, and experience severe differential settlement.

Custom Waterproofing & Piering Methods for Western PA Properties

Fixing a foundation in Pittsburgh demands a deep understanding of local geology. Standard, cookie-cutter fixes simply cannot withstand our hillside forces. Permanent stabilization requires a customized engineering approach that addresses both water entry and structural shifting.

  • Sub-Floor Interior Drainage Networks: To combat the massive hydrostatic pressure coming down the hillside, an interior sub-floor drainage system creates a reliable path of least resistance. A channel is carefully broken out around the indoor perimeter of your basement slab, and weep holes are drilled into the bottom row of blocks to safely drain the wall cores. This water is collected by a perforated conduit and routed directly into a high-capacity submersible sump pump array, keeping the basement floor dry and relieving water pressure before it can warp the masonry framing.
  • Steel Resistance Underpinning Piers: If soil creep or slope settlement has caused a portion of your home to sink, structural steel piers offer the ultimate solution. Heavy-duty steel brackets are secured to your foundation’s footing, and high-strength steel pier sections are driven deep into the ground using hydraulic equipment. These piers push straight through the weak, moving topsoil until they strike solid, load-bearing bedrock. Once anchored, your home’s weight is transferred off the moving hillside and onto solid steel pillars, permanently halting the sinking cycle.

FAQ: Foundation Concerns Around Pittsburgh

Why do hillside homes in Pittsburgh experience more foundation cracks?

Hillside homes in Pittsburgh often experience more foundation cracks because saturated soil moves downhill and pushes unevenly against basement walls. This added lateral pressure can cause cracks, bowing walls, and water intrusion over time.

Can a retaining wall solve my Pittsburgh foundation leak?

A retaining wall can help manage surface runoff and soil movement, but it usually does not stop groundwater pressure around the foundation. Basement leaks often require a drainage system, sump pump, or waterproofing solution installed at the foundation level.

How long do foundation repairs take in Western PA?

Most foundation repair or basement waterproofing projects in Western PA take 2 to 4 days, depending on the severity of the damage, the repair method, and the size of the basement or foundation area.

Will foundation cracks get worse if they are left unrepaired?

Yes. Small foundation cracks can widen over time as water infiltration, hydrostatic pressure, and soil movement continue to stress the foundation. Addressing the problem early can help prevent more extensive structural repairs.

What foundation repair solution works best for Pittsburgh hillside homes?

The right solution depends on the cause of the problem. Carbon fiber reinforcement can stabilize cracked walls, while steel resistance piers address settlement. Many hillside homes also benefit from an interior drainage system to relieve hydrostatic pressure.

Does hydrostatic pressure cause basement leaks in Pittsburgh?

Yes. Hydrostatic pressure is one of the leading causes of basement leaks in Pittsburgh. When saturated clay soil pushes against foundation walls, water can enter through cracks, joints, or porous concrete unless a proper waterproofing system is installed.
